I am seeking an Occupational Health Technician in the Swindon and Wiltshire area to join our expanding peripatetic team. In this role, you will be required to travel across the UK, driving a Mobile Medical Unit (MMU) to client sites to deliver high-quality health surveillance services. This is a varied and rewarding role that plays a vital part in ensuring the health and wellbeing of employees across a range of industries.

This is a great opportunity for an enthusiastic and reliable individual to expand their skills and experience in a supportive environment, where you’ll be given a 4-week Training and Induction Programme with ongoing mentoring and support from the team.

Key Responsibilities

  • Conduct health surveillance screenings, including audiometry, lung function testing, and baseline measurements such as height, weight, blood pressure, and urinalysis.
  • Accurately record all medical information in occupational health records and ensure it is passed to the relevant clinical staff.
  • Maintain and ensure all equipment is clean, serviceable, and fit for purpose.
  • Support health promotion activities and other additional tasks as required.
  • Assist the wider occupational health team by gathering and recording accurate information to support clinical decision-making.
  • Provide biometric data through screening procedures to enable nursing and physician staff to make informed clinical decisions regarding patient management.

Travel & Overnight stays
You must have the facility to park the MMU at or near your home address overnight and be comfortable with the travel required for the role, which will include regular overnight stays. We advise that you can be away from home for around 3 out of 4 weeks of the month, however we will always bring you home on the Friday for the weekend.


To support a positive work life balance, you will have:

•    Diary Visibility 6 weeks in advance
•    Subsistence for each night you are away from home
•    Access to a Premier Inn account for ease of booking
•    Issue of a fuel card
